What equipment is used for ECT at Suburban Hospital?

0

Suburban Hospital’s ECT technology allows treatment with ultra-brief stimulation down to 25ms pulse width. This ability to control the parameters of the electrical stimulus is paramount in minimizing the risk of memory impairment, a side effect more commonly associated with higher pulse widths of energy delivery.
